Chapter 11 – Covenant and Purpose
The day after the confrontation with Sinestro, Bruce returns to school and gathers Jess, Barry and Clark. He takes them to Wayne Manor, now rebuilt with the help of his secret technology. There, he reveals the Batcave and proposes that they form a team to protect themselves from the government organization ANGOS, which now has records on all of them. The four young heroes agree that they need to act together and officially become the Justice League X. Bruce equips them with suits made from alien technology from the former Green Lantern's ship. Alfred, now a cyborg, remains connected to the cameras that the group installs around the city to monitor crimes in real time.
📘 Chapter 12 – Bonds, Garb, and Surveillance
Each hero receives their own custom uniform: Jess sports a bright emerald suit with martial elegance; Barry dons a red and gold uniform with pulsating energy circuits; Clark gets a blue suit with a glowing Kryptonian symbol on the chest; and Bruce dons his new tactical heavy armor with alien components. The group will base itself in the Batcave, with Alfred acting as operator and remote support. The group strengthens their bond of trust, while also sharing the threats they face from ANGOS. Urban surveillance begins, marking the beginning of the Justice League X's covert work as the silent defenders of Gotham and the planet.

Chapter 9: The Last Threat
The shockwave from the colossus's explosion echoed across Gotham. Clark staggered from the impact, his hyper-acute senses engaging the sound of the reanimated ANGOS agents' screams as their consciousnesses finally shattered free of Sinestro's hold.
“That’s a done deal,” Clark said, debris brushing his shoulders as he approached the other heroes. He looked at Amanda seriously. “You’re right, Director. With Jess, Barry, and the others, maybe we can make a big difference out there.”
Meanwhile, Batman was already scanning the area with his sensors.
“Any sign of Sinestro breaking free?” Clark asked. “Not at the moment,” Bruce replied. “But we need to be prepared. He’s not going down without a fight.”
Jess and Barry stood together, laughing silently even in the midst of the chaos. Amanda watched them with a mixed expression—wariness and hope.
“Let's focus on containing Sinestro for now. We can discuss our next steps once he's defeated.”
Suddenly, a new wave of yellow energy erupted from where Sinestro lay. Illusions began to distort the surroundings—trees twisted, the sky shimmered, and the heroes found themselves trapped in illusory realities for seconds as Sinestro escaped to his cloaked ship.
Before they could react, the ship took off and disappeared into the starry sky, vanishing into hyperspace. The villain had escaped.
While the heroes were still processing their escape, ANGOS helicopters surrounded Wayne Manor, now in ruins.
Amanda Waller, cold and implacable: “For reasons of national security, all those involved will be questioned.”
The young heroes, exhausted and confused, began to raise their hands in surrender. Batman hesitated. His sensors picked up a faint signal among the rubble. He looked—Alfred.
